DEVELOPMENT OF LINOIT DIGITAL MEDIA FOR GERMAN NARRATIVE TEXT READING SKILLS OF ELEVENTH GRADE STUDENTS IN THE SECOND SEMESTER

Learning to read German narrative texts among 11th grade students at SMAN 1 Gedangan still faces obstacles in vocabulary mastery and text comprehension. The media used tends to be less interactive and is not yet in line with the characteristics of students in the digital age. This study aims to develop Linoit digital media and determine its suitability in supporting reading skills. The research used the Research and Development (R&D) method with the ADDIE model, limited to the Analysis, Design, and Development stages. The product was a Linoit-based virtual whiteboard containing narrative texts, vocabulary, supporting images, and interactive activities. Data collection techniques were carried out through expert material and media validation sheets. The validation results showed that both subject matter experts and media experts obtained a feasibility percentage of 94% in the highly feasible category. Based on the research results, this media meets the aspects of content, appearance, and ease of use, so it is declared feasible for use as a more interactive and effective learning alternative in improving German reading skills.
